Summary

The Automatic Identification Technology-7 (AIT-7) opportunity is a combined synopsis and solicitation issued by the Department of Defense, specifically the Army. This contract focuses on the procurement of advanced automatic identification technologies, which are essential for enhancing operational efficiency and accuracy in various military applications. Contractors with expertise in manufacturing or supplying automatic identification systems, including hardware and software solutions, are encouraged to bid on this opportunity. The work will likely involve providing innovative technology solutions that meet the specific needs of the Army, with orders potentially being placed at various locations, including Fort Gregg-Adams.
